Play a Webex Recording
Hosts can download and play back their recordings for Webex meetings, events, and training sessions. Hosts can also share the link for each of their recordings. If you missed a meeting, event, or training session, you can ask the host for a link to the recording. Recordings are also great for future reference. Even if you weren't originally invited, the host can still provide you with a link to their recording.
The standard format for all recordings is MP4. Depending on your site settings, Webex displays a disclaimer each time that you download or play a recording. Accept the terms of the disclaimer to continue.
1 | Depending on your role, do one of the following:
If You're the Host |
If You're an Invitee or Attendee |
Go to Recordings and then locate and click the recording that you want to play.
|
Select the link in the email sent to you by the host.
OR
Paste the URL that the host provides into your web browser.
|
|
2 | When the player appears, select Play.
If a disclaimer appears, select Accept to accept the terms and continue.
